Startrax will be taking bookings for 32 drivers for this event, this will be made up of 2 heats, 16 cars per heat. Anyone booking in after that limit will go onto a reserve list for anyone who fails to make the grid on the day.

This years F2 Ladies Charity Race is being staged at Sheffield on Sunday 13 November as part of the Startrax season finale with F1's, F2's and the Heritage Cars. The cost will remain unchanged for each Lady driver at £15.00 for a day licence which will also cover the insurance aspect. Trophies for this event will be arranged and provided by Startrax. All Ladies entering for this event will receive a sponsporship form with confirmation of there booking, all proceeds collected will be going to the F2 Drivers Benevolent Fund. For anyone that has already booked in for this event a sponsorship for will be sent to you shortly. In addition to money being raised for the Ben Fund Startrax will donate £10.00 per raced car in the Ladies Race to Sheffield Childrens Hospital. Bookings are now being taken by contacting Startrax, any Lady booking in for this event will need to provide there name and the car number they will be using. Driver numbers will be strictly limited on safety grounds so get your entry in early.
